As the days grow shorter and the weather turns cooler, there's nothing quite like a hearty and comforting stew to warm you up from the inside out. This Harvest Pork Stew is the perfect dish to enjoy on a chilly autumn evening, with its rich and flavorful broth, tender chunks of pork, and a variety of seasonal vegetables. Whether you're hosting a casual dinner party or simply craving a cozy, home-cooked meal, this recipe is sure to hit the spot.
One of the best parts about this Harvest Pork Stew is that it's incredibly versatile and can be tailored to suit your personal taste preferences and dietary needs. You can easily swap out the vegetables for whatever is in season or whatever you have on hand, making it a great way to use up any leftover produce in your fridge. And if you're looking to make it a bit heartier, you can also add in some additional ingredients like beans or barley.
But the real star of this stew is the pork. We recommend using a good quality cut of pork, such as pork shoulder or pork loin, as it will become wonderfully tender and flavorful as it simmers away in the broth. And if you're a fan of using your slow cooker, this recipe can easily be adapted to cook low and slow, allowing the flavors to meld together and the pork to become melt-in-your-mouth tender.
